Job Summary:

An Assistant Farm Manager is responsible for supporting the Farm Manager with the day to day management of the farm, ensuring that the stock is produced of the highest standard which ensuring you and all on the farm maintain safe working practices. The Assistant Farm Manager is also responsible for site security and biosecurity. You will provide holiday or absence cover for the Farm Manager.

Duties:

Manage the farms to ensure that bird welfare is never compromised
Manage and monitor ventilation, heating, feed, water, litter and lighting within the agreed standards, ensuring the highest quality conditions are provided.
Communicate with the Farm Manager ensuring that information is provided promptly and accurately.
Manage and control Visitors/Contractors on site ensuring that work is carried out to required specification and quality and work is carried out in a safe manner.
Ensure all paperwork is accurately recorded
Cover the alarm as required ensuring it is operational and any faults rectified immediately
Ensure that Site Security is maintained at all times, and report any issues
Ensure that Site is maintained in clean, tidy and presentable manner.
Ensure that the Company Health & Safety Policy is adhered to at all times.
Ensure that all Codes of Practice are adhered to at all times.
Flexible approach will be necessary as this role will necessitate working at weekends with some early morning and late evening work.
Provide holiday / sickness cover for Line Manager as required.
Undertake any other duties as required to fulfil the needs of the position
Attend training courses which are determined as appropriate by the Company
Ensure compliance with Red Tractor Assurance Scheme
Ensure site is audit ready at all times.
